(a) The judge / (b) asked Ravi / (c) if he knew / (d) the thief. Spot the error.

Aa

Bb

Cc

Dd

Answer:

C. c

Read Explanation:

Replace if he knew with whether he knew . "Whether" is used to introduce alternatives or express doubt, especially in formal contexts. 'Whether’ should be used in place of ‘if since ‘whether or’ is the correct correlative. 'If' is used when there is a condition in the sentence.
